3.2 Disable the Shutdown port (2024)

Information

Tomcat listens on TCP port 8005 to accept shutdown requests. By connecting to this port and sending the SHUTDOWN command, all applications within Tomcat are halted. The shutdown port is not exposed to the network as it is bound to the loopback interface. If this functionality is not used, it is recommended that the shutdown port be disabled.

Rationale:

Disabling the Shutdown port will eliminate the risk of malicious local entities using the shutdown command to disable the Tomcat server.

Solution

Set the port to -1 in the $CATALINA_HOME/conf/server.xml to disable the shutdown port:

<Server port='-1' shutdown='SHUTDOWN'>

Default Value:

The shutdown port is enabled on TCP port 8005, bound to the loopback address.

See Also

https://workbench.cisecurity.org/files/4103

3.2 Disable the Shutdown port (2024)

FAQs

How do I disable the shutdown port in Tomcat? ›

The TCP/IP port number on which this server waits for a shutdown command. Set to -1 to disable the shutdown port. Note: Disabling the shutdown port works well when Tomcat is started using Apache Commons Daemon (running as a service on Windows or with jsvc on un*xes).

What is the shutdown port number? ›

The shutdown port is enabled on TCP port 8005, bound to the loopback address.

How to stop Tomcat running on port 8080? ›

  1. On MS Windows, select Start > All Programs > Accessories > System Tools >Resource Monitor.
  2. Expand the Network Tab.
  3. Move to the section for Listening Ports.
  4. Look in the Port column and scroll to find entry for port 8080.
  5. Select the given process and delete/kill the process.
Dec 13, 2015

What runs on port 8005? ›

Tomcat is a popular open-source Java Servlet Container that is widely used to deploy web applications. One common issue that users may encounter is that the Tomcat server may crash when the SMS Agent Host service is using the same port (8005) This Port is used by either Tomcat Shutdown server or Connector Port.

How to disable HTTP port in Tomcat? ›

Procedure
  1. Start the ncm-as service.
  2. Open the $VOYENCE_HOME/ncmcore/conf/server. xml file.
  3. Comment out the following section to remove the HTTP port reference: <Connector port="8881" protocol="HTTP/1.1"^M connectionTimeout="20000"^M redirectPort="8880" /> ^M.
  4. Save the file.
  5. Restart the ncm-as service.
May 13, 2022

How do I disable server port? ›

Windows
  1. Find the process ID (PID) of the port (replace the 'portNumber' with the number) netstat -ano | findstr :portNumber. Copy the PID number for the next step.
  2. Kill the process. First, try this (replace typeyourPIDhere with the number you copied above): taskkill /PID typeyourPIDhere /F.
Mar 30, 2020

How do I enable or disable a port? ›

To disable a port:

Go to System Settings > Network and click All Interfaces. The interface list opens. Double-click on a port, right-click on a port then select Edit from the pop-up menu, or select a port then click Edit in the toolbar.

What ports to disable? ›

Common High-Risk Ports
PortProtocolRecommended Action
139TCP and UDPDisable always.
445TCP and UDPDisable always.
161TCP and UDPDisable always.
389TCP and UDPDisable always.
28 more rows
Apr 6, 2023

How do I disable port 80? ›

To disable port 80, go to Windows Firewall with Advanced Security (just type it in the Start search box). On the left you'll see Outbound Rules, right-click on it and select New Rule... Then, select Port in rule type and hit Next. Select protocol TCP and type 80 in the Specific Remote Port box.

How to check if Tomcat is running on port 8080? ›

Use a browser to check whether Tomcat is running on URL http://localhost:8080 , where 8080 is the Tomcat port specified in conf/server. xml. If Tomcat is running properly and you specified the correct port, the browser displays the Tomcat homepage.

How do I stop port 8080 service? ›

  1. First of all, you need to find which process open the port.
  2. Run this command: netstat -aon | findstr 8080.
  3. Then you will see something like this.
  4. The number 9260 is the process ID owning the port 8080. ...
  5. Then you need to find what program is running as process id 9260:
  6. and you may see something like this.
  7. Or, you can.
Dec 6, 2021

How do I stop Tomcat from running? ›

Open Task Manager, and select More details if not already expanded. Select the Services tab. Locate and select IDM Apps Tomcat Service and right-click, then select Start, Stop, or Restart. NOTE:If the Task Manager Services does not restart, it could be due to the time it takes for Stop to finish.

How to change Tomcat shutdown port? ›

To change the port number, follow the steps below:
  1. Shutdown the Tomcat application server.
  2. In the Tomcat installation folder, open the Conf directory.
  3. Create a backup of the server. ...
  4. Modify the original server.xml file and search for '8080'. ...
  5. Modify the value of the port parameter to the desired value.
Jun 22, 2017

What is the port 8009 used for? ›

Apache JServ Protocol (AJP) is used for communication between Tomcat and Apache web server. This protocol is binary and is enabled by default. Anytime the web server is started, AJP protocol is started on port 8009. It is primarily used as a reverse proxy to communicate with application servers.

What is TCP port 8008? ›

TCP port 8008 is the default port used by OWASP's WebScarab project. See http://www.owasp.org/index.php/WebScarab_Getting_Started for more details. FrSIRT. 2005-08-18 21:25:19. This port is used by Novell eDirectory Server iMonitor which is vulnerable to a critical stack overflow.

How do I stop port 22? ›

You can use sudo ufw deny ssh . This will just block port 22, not the new port you have assigned for ssh .

What is graceful shutdown Tomcat? ›

Graceful shutdown is supported with all four embedded web servers (Jetty, Reactor Netty, Tomcat, and Undertow) and with both reactive and servlet-based web applications. It occurs as part of closing the application context and is performed in the earliest phase of stopping SmartLifecycle beans.

How to change port 8005 in Tomcat? ›

If you use Eclipse then double click on servers and double click on tomcat server then one file will open. In that file change HTTP port to some other port number and save( Ctrl + S ) then again start the server. This error comes because tomcat may be running in background so first stop that server..

How to disable option method in Tomcat? ›

To restrict HTTP methods, such as OPTIONS, add a <security-constraints> element inside <tomcat>/conf/web. xml. Below is an example where the methods OPTIONS and DELETE are disabled. The tag <auth-constraint/> in the example means that no role can access the specified methods and the methods are completely disallowed.

Top Articles
Important Things to Consider When Naming Noncitizens in Your Estate Plan
What are the benefits of premium tyres? – Merityre Specialists
Encore Atlanta Cheer Competition
Avonlea Havanese
Skamania Lodge Groupon
Ofw Pinoy Channel Su
Kobold Beast Tribe Guide and Rewards
Dr Klabzuba Okc
Acts 16 Nkjv
Nesb Routing Number
Xrarse
A Fashion Lover's Guide To Copenhagen
Craigslist Estate Sales Tucson
Craigslist/Phx
Think Up Elar Level 5 Answer Key Pdf
Craiglist Galveston
Who called you from 6466062860 (+16466062860) ?
Northeastern Nupath
MLB power rankings: Red-hot Chicago Cubs power into September, NL wild-card race
Bella Bodhi [Model] - Bio, Height, Body Stats, Family, Career and Net Worth 
Terry Bradshaw | Biography, Stats, & Facts
Exl8000 Generator Battery
Timeline of the September 11 Attacks
Craigslist List Albuquerque: Your Ultimate Guide to Buying, Selling, and Finding Everything - First Republic Craigslist
1979 Ford F350 For Sale Craigslist
Weather Underground Durham
91 Octane Gas Prices Near Me
Robert A McDougal: XPP Tutorial
Was heißt AMK? » Bedeutung und Herkunft des Ausdrucks
Salons Open Near Me Today
new haven free stuff - craigslist
Ixl Lausd Northwest
Babbychula
Weekly Math Review Q4 3
2008 DODGE RAM diesel for sale - Gladstone, OR - craigslist
Culver's of Whitewater, WI - W Main St
Trap Candy Strain Leafly
Simnet Jwu
התחבר/י או הירשם/הירשמי כדי לראות.
13 Fun &amp; Best Things to Do in Hurricane, Utah
Streameast Io Soccer
Nearest Wintrust Bank
Dying Light Mother's Day Roof
Displacer Cub – 5th Edition SRD
Scott Surratt Salary
House For Sale On Trulia
Acuity Eye Group - La Quinta Photos
Greg Steube Height
Kindlerso
Primary Care in Nashville & Southern KY | Tristar Medical Group
Latest Posts
Article information

Author: Gov. Deandrea McKenzie

Last Updated:

Views: 6418

Rating: 4.6 / 5 (46 voted)

Reviews: 93% of readers found this page helpful

Author information

Name: Gov. Deandrea McKenzie

Birthday: 2001-01-17

Address: Suite 769 2454 Marsha Coves, Debbieton, MS 95002

Phone: +813077629322

Job: Real-Estate Executive

Hobby: Archery, Metal detecting, Kitesurfing, Genealogy, Kitesurfing, Calligraphy, Roller skating

Introduction: My name is Gov. Deandrea McKenzie, I am a spotless, clean, glamorous, sparkling, adventurous, nice, brainy person who loves writing and wants to share my knowledge and understanding with you.